Draught-proofing can be carried out using numerous techniques and materials customized to the specifics of the sash window. Below are the most typical approaches:
1. Weatherstripping
Weatherstripping includes using a strip of product around the window's frame to develop a seal. This method is flexible and can accommodate differing space sizes.
Kinds of Weatherstripping:Felt: Inexpensive and simple to apply however not really long lasting.Vinyl: Offers much better insulation and is more weather-resistant.Foam Tape: A simple, self-adhesive alternative that provides excellent insulation.2. Draught Excluders
Draught excluders are products put at the base of the window sill to prevent cold air from getting in. These can be permanent or detachable, depending upon individual choice.
Choices Include:PVC Draught Excluders: Affordable and effective for long-term usage.Fabric Draught Excluders: These can include an ornamental element while serving their practical function.3. Secondary Glazing
Secondary glazing includes installing a second layer of glazing to create an insulating barrier. This not just reduces draughts but also boosts soundproofing and thermal performance.
Advantages of Secondary Glazing:Lower setup expenses compared to complete window replacement.Increased insulation without altering the look of the initial sash window.4. Insulating Paint
While not a direct type of draught proofing, insulating paint can be applied to the window frame to lower heat transfer. This approach is less typical however beneficial for enhancing overall window efficiency.
5. Window Films
Window movies can improve insulation and reduce glare. These films are easy to use and can offer additional UV security.
Step-by-Step Guide to Draught Proofing Sash Windows
Below is a streamlined step-by-step guide for homeowners interested in draught proofing their sash windows:
Step 1: Assess the GapsDetermine areas where air is leaking. This can be done by running your hand around the window frame or using a candle to find drafts.Action 2: Clean the AreaMake sure that the locations around the window frames are clean and complimentary from particles to guarantee proper adhesion of products.Step 3: Choose Your MethodSelect the proper draught-proofing method or combination of methods based upon the size of gaps and spending plan.Step 4: Install WeatherstrippingApply the chosen weatherstripping around the window frames, following the manufacturer's instructions for finest outcomes.Step 5: Position Draught ExcludersLocation draught excluders at the base of the window sill if required, ensuring a snug fit.Step 6: Regular MaintenanceRegularly check the window seals and Draught excluders to ensure they remain effective. Change them if wear and tear are evident.FAQs about Sash Window Draught Proofing
